Moving from Helena to Billings:
The Real Cost
Moving from Helena to Billings requires about $11,905 upfront. Monthly living costs fall by $57/mo, and the estimated break-even point is beyond the first year.

Move Decision Checklist
- Set aside the full upfront cost before assuming monthly savings will make the move affordable.
- Ask whether salary changes, state taxes, and commute costs offset the destination's lower headline cost.
- Compare rent, salary-needed, and full city-vs-city pages before signing a lease or booking movers.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does it cost to move from Helena to Billings?
The estimated one-time moving cost is $11,905, including security deposit, moving truck/service, travel, temporary housing, and setup fees. Monthly living costs will decrease by $57/mo.
Is Billings cheaper than Helena?
Yes, Billings (index 96) is 2% cheaper than Helena (index 98) overall.
